Sides QP and RQ of ΔPQR are produced to points S and T respectively. If ∠SPR =135° and ∠PQT = 110° find ∠PRQ. In Fig. 6.39.

Solution:
∠SPR+∠QPR=180° (Linear Pair)
⇒∠QPR=180°−∠SPR=180°−135°=45°
∠PQT=∠QPR+∠PRQ
(If a side of a triangle is produced, then the exterior angle is equal to the sum of two interior opposite angles.)
⇒110°=45°+∠PRQ
⇒∠PRQ=110°−45°=65°
